May 8, 2004 Manny Pacquiao and Juan Manhuel Marquez had a very interesting match. Pacquiao knocked Marquez down three times in the first round, but Marquez weathered the storm and fought back effectively enough to earn a split draw. It was pretty exciting. Yet seemed unfair and so worthy of a rematch. Since then, Pacquiao has gone 7-1 with wins over Morales (twice) and Barrera. Now, four years later the wait is over, Pacquiao vs Marquez are scheduled for a rematch. The fight will take place on March 15, 2008 at Mandalay Bay in Las Vegas, Nevada airing on HBO pay-per-view. If Pacquiao wins, he will likely move up to lightweight for a July meeting with WBA champ David Diaz, who will defend his title on the Pacquaio-Marquez undercard. There is also speculation that if Pacquiao gets by both Marquez and Diaz - talk about looking ahead - he could face Oscar De La Hoya in September in what would be billed as the Golden Boy’s career finale.
